Paperback. Condition: Very Good. In Poetic Dialogues, Sandra Buechler highlights poetry's potential as a vehicle for an empathic understanding of others, and of ourselves. In order to hone the art of analytic interpretation, Buechler suggests reading poetry, among other activities. Poetry often provides an excellent venue for be…coming acclimated to economical, truthful, direct language. Many poems deliver pithy and memorable phrases. They come for an hour and stay for a lifetime. They model the courage to look in a mirror and say what you see. They palpably demonstrate our common humanity. By giving voice to sorrow, loneliness, shame, joy, and other human experiences they close the distance between self and other. Some poems provide touchstones that make us feel whole. Our lives may make a little more sense, listening to them. Like good interpretations, some poems help us weave together seemingly disparate experiences. Poetry, like psychoanalysis, deals with big subjects- time, loss, death, beauty, childhood, nature, and the good life, among others. Poems are not afraid of mystery. Like psychoanalysis, they may let meaning happen slowly. They leaven sorrow and foster wonder. A good poem, like a meaningful interpretation, may introduce us to the stranger within ourselves.

Collection of papers and reflections examining psychoanalytic identity development, postgraduate training integration, and sustaining… clinical careers, exploring how psychoanalysts forge signature styles, address training assumptions, professional burnout, and maintain hope and emotional engagement while balancing neutrality requirements for psychoanalytic candidates, trainees, supervisors, and experienced practitioners. Author Sandra Buechler, Training and Supervising Analyst at William Alanson White Institute, draws on decades of clinical experience, teaching, and supervision to explore how psychoanalysts forge signature styles distinct from graduate school technique mastery. The volume addresses fundamental questions about analytic training program assumptions, candidate preparation for contemporary practice challenges, professional burnout risks across career spans, and roots of professional inadequacy that can limit clinician satisfaction and effectiveness. Buechler emphasizes identity development through contrasts - examining how exposure to diverse supervisory and teaching approaches enables trainees to validate, modify, and crystallize core beliefs about therapeutic work.

Paperback. Condition: Good. "Still practicing" has several meanings. Still practicing suggests that the balance of heartaches and joys must not deter us from pursuing a clinical practice. At the same time, still practicing suggests that for the clinician "practice" never "makes perfect." We continue to refine our clinical instru…ments over our entire working lives.Framed by her previous work on the concept of emotional balance, Sandra Buechler investigates how vicissitudes in a clinical career can have a profound and lasting impact on the clinician's emotional balance, and considers how the clinician's resilience is maintained in the face of the personal fallout of a lifetime of clinical practice. At each juncture, from training to early phases of clinical experience, through mid and late career, she asks, what can help us maintain a vital interest in our work? How do we not burn out?Aimed at the nexus of the personal and theoretical, Still Practicing concentrates on the sadness, feelings of shame, and satisfactions inherent in practice, and encourages newcomers and veterans alike to make career choices mindful of their potential long-term impact on their feelings about being therapists. It poses a question vital to the life of the clinician: How can we strike a balance between the work's inevitable pain and its potential joy.
